Skip to content

Abandoned Cart Recovery

Automated email sequences to recover abandoned shopping carts. One-time purchase (vs $29-99/month for SaaS like Klaviyo).

Overview

Automated email sequences to recover abandoned shopping carts. Integrates with WooCommerce to detect cart abandonment and sends timed, personalized recovery emails. Recovers 10-30% of abandoned carts.

[Image placeholder: Product hero / outcome screenshot]

What you’ll achieve

  • Automate: Python recovery automation script.
  • React in real time with webhook-based triggers.
  • Keep branding and messaging consistent with templates.
  • Automate: Personalization engine (product images, cart contents).
  • Measure results with clear tracking and exports.

What it does

  • Python recovery automation script
  • WooCommerce webhook receiver
  • Email sequence templates (3-email series)
  • Personalization engine (product images, cart contents)
  • Tracking and analytics module
  • Discount code generation (optional)
  • Unsubscribe handling

[Image placeholder: Workflow diagram / before-after]

What you get (download)

  • A ZIP package you download and run yourself
  • Setup instructions and example configuration
  • Templates/sample files to validate your first run quickly

Inputs required (from you)

  • WooCommerce site URL and REST API credentials
  • SMTP credentials (or email API key: Mailgun, SendGrid)
  • Email templates (or use defaults with branding)
  • Company branding (logo, colors, from name)
  • Timing preferences (e.g., 1 hour, 24 hours, 72 hours)
  • Discount offer (optional - e.g., 10% off code)

How to use it (simple flow)

  • Set your config (accounts/keys/settings) once.
  • Run a test with sample data.
  • Go live and schedule it (cron) or run on demand.
  • Review outputs/logs and iterate.

[Image placeholder: CLI run / sample output]

Why it’s different

  • One-time purchase (vs $29-99/month for SaaS like Klaviyo)
  • No per-email fees
  • Full control over templates and timing
  • Works with any WooCommerce store
  • Includes discount code automation

Technical details

  • Language: Python 3.10+
  • Dependencies: Flask, requests, Jinja2, smtplib
  • Database: SQLite for tracking carts
  • Email: SMTP or API (Mailgun, SendGrid)
  • Hosting: Requires always-on server (VPS or client's hosting)

FAQ

What do I receive after purchase? A ZIP download you run yourself. It includes setup instructions and example configuration so you can validate your first run quickly.

Does this require any monthly fees? No monthly fees for the software. If you connect to third‑party APIs (email providers, SERP APIs, etc.), those vendors may charge usage-based fees.

Do I need API keys or credentials? If the product integrates with third‑party platforms, yes — you’ll provide your own credentials so everything runs under your account.

What tech does it use? Language: Python 3.10+ (plus standard dependencies listed in the package).

Pricing & CTA

This is a one-time purchase. You download the software and run it on your own machine or server. If the product integrates with third-party APIs, those providers may have their own usage costs.

[Image placeholder: Call-to-action / purchase block]